SFET Financial Results: FY2020 Revenue Grew 49% to Record $4.9 Million
On March 22, 2021, Safe-T Group released financial results showing record revenues and profits during full-year 2020. Revenues for the year totaled a record $4.9 million, which represents a 49% increase year-over-year from 2019. Furthermore, full year gross profits surged 71% year-over-year to a record of $2.4 million. The cybersecurity company’s Q4 2020 results showed year-over-year growth of 16%.
Safe-T remains very well capitalized, after offerings earlier this year helped the company increase its cash balance to $22 million. Management notes that its significant cash assets will give the company the ability to continue its mergers & acquisitions efforts, as well as continuing to expand current businesses.

Here are some highlights how ZoneZero can help organizations secure access to users that may be internal employees (in office), external employees with VPN (work from home), and even external non-VPN contractors:
• ZoneZero™ Quick Access – Unique, Fast and Password-Less Access to Corporate Resources
o Protection against brute force, injections, and dist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attacks;
o Quick Access with Telegram and WhatsApp applications, utilized as a strong and simple path to use multi-factor authentication (MFA);
o Quick Access with biometric based MFA solutions; and
o Quick Access with Quick Response (QR) code-based MFA.
• Identity-Based Segmentation Capabilities for Enhanced Security
o Network segmentation isolation, separating assets based on identities within the organization infrastructure;
o Support for per-user and per-service MFA;
o Manager approval MFA; and
o Re-authentication MFA for sensitive services.
• Improved Management and Deployment – Dramatically Reducing Solution Deployment Time to Just a Few Hours
o Redesign of management interface for simpler configuration;
o Configuration unification across all deployment options; and
o New docker-based container to simplify on-premises or hybrid deployment.
• Monitoring and Reporting
o Introduction of new user-based reports, tracking entire user-access flow; and
o Introduction of new system level reports, allowing to monitor and plan ZoneZero™ capacity, and aligning it to purchased license and capacity.
